# MCI Schema Reference

> This document provides a complete reference for the Model Context Interface (MCI) JSON schema v1. It describes all fields, types, execution configurations, authentication options, and templating syntax supported by the MCI Python adapter

## Overview

MCI (Model Context Interface) uses a schema to define tools that AI agents can execute. The schema can be written in either **JSON** or **YAML** format - both are fully supported and produce identical results.

Each tool specifies:

* What it does (metadata and description)
* What inputs it accepts (JSON Schema)
* How to execute it (execution configuration)

The schema is designed to be platform-agnostic, secure (secrets via environment variables), and supports multiple execution types.

**Schema Version**: `1.0`

**Supported File Formats**:

* JSON (`.json`)
* YAML (`.yaml`, `.yml`)

***

## Top-Level Schema Structure

The root MCI context file has these main fields:

| Field                | Type    | Required     | Description                                                         |
| -------------------- | ------- | ------------ | ------------------------------------------------------------------- |
| `schemaVersion`      | string  | **Required** | MCI schema version (e.g., `"1.0"`)                                  |
| `metadata`           | object  | Optional     | Descriptive metadata about the tool collection                      |
| `tools`              | array   | Optional\*   | Array of tool definitions                                           |
| `toolsets`           | array   | Optional\*   | Array of toolset references to load from library                    |
| `mcp_servers`        | object  | Optional     | MCP servers to register and cache (see [MCP Servers](#mcp-servers)) |
| `libraryDir`         | string  | Optional     | Directory to find toolset files (default: `"./mci"`)                |
| `enableAnyPaths`     | boolean | Optional     | Allow any file path (default: `false`)                              |
| `directoryAllowList` | array   | Optional     | Additional allowed directories (default: `[]`)                      |

**Note:** Either `tools`, `toolsets`, or `mcp_servers` (or any combination) must be provided.

### Toolsets

**`toolsets`** (array, optional)

* Array of toolset definitions that reference tool collections in the library directory
* Each toolset can optionally apply schema-level filtering to control which tools are loaded
* Allows organizing tools into reusable, modular collections

**`libraryDir`** (string, default: `"./mci"`)

* Directory path where toolset files are located, relative to the main schema file
* Can be customized to use a different directory structure

#### Toolset Object

Each toolset object supports these fields:

| Field         | Type   | Required     | Description                                                     |
| ------------- | ------ | ------------ | --------------------------------------------------------------- |
| `name`        | string | **Required** | Name of toolset file/directory in `libraryDir`                  |
| `filter`      | string | Optional     | Filter type: `"only"`, `"except"`, `"tags"`, or `"withoutTags"` |
| `filterValue` | string | Required\*   | Comma-separated list of tool names or tags                      |

**\* Required when `filter` is specified**

**Toolset Name Resolution**:

* First checks for a directory: `{libraryDir}/{name}/`
  * If found, loads all `.mci.json` files in the directory
* Then checks for direct file: `{libraryDir}/{name}`
* Then checks with extension: `{libraryDir}/{name}.mci.json`
* Also supports `.mci.yaml` and `.mci.yml` extensions

**Schema-Level Filters**:

* `only`: Include only tools with specified names
* `except`: Exclude tools with specified names
* `tags`: Include only tools with at least one matching tag
* `withoutTags`: Exclude tools with any matching tag

### Security Fields

**`enableAnyPaths`** (boolean, default: `false`)

* When `true`, disables all path validation for file and CLI execution
* When `false` (default), restricts access to schema directory and allowed directories
* Can be overridden per-tool
* **Use with caution** - enables access to any file on the system

**`directoryAllowList`** (array of strings, default: `[]`)

* List of additional directories to allow for file/CLI access
* Can be absolute paths (e.g., `/home/user/data`) or relative to schema directory (e.g., `./configs`)
* Schema directory is always allowed by default
* Can be overridden per-tool

### MCP Servers

The `mcp_servers` field enables integration with Model Context Protocol servers.
**`mcp_servers`** (object, optional)

* Object mapping server names to MCP server configurations
* Allows integration with Model Context Protocol (MCP) servers
* Tools from MCP servers are automatically cached in `{libraryDir}/mcp/` directory
* Each server configuration can include filtering and expiration settings
* Supports both STDIO (local command-based) and HTTP (web-based) servers

#### MCP Server Configuration

Each server in the `mcp_servers` object has a unique name as the key and a configuration object with these fields:

**STDIO Configuration:**

| Field     | Type             | Required | Default | Description                                  |
| --------- | ---------------- | -------- | ------- | -------------------------------------------- |
| `command` | string           | Yes      | -       | Command to execute (e.g., `"npx"`, `"uvx"`)  |
| `args`    | array of strings | No       | `[]`    | Arguments to pass to the command             |
| `env`     | object           | No       | `{}`    | Environment variables for the server process |
| `config`  | object           | No       | -       | Optional caching and filtering configuration |

**HTTP Configuration:**

| Field     | Type   | Required | Default | Description                                  |
| --------- | ------ | -------- | ------- | -------------------------------------------- |
| `type`    | string | Yes      | -       | Must be `"http"`                             |
| `url`     | string | Yes      | -       | Server URL endpoint                          |
| `headers` | object | No       | `{}`    | HTTP headers (e.g., for authentication)      |
| `config`  | object | No       | -       | Optional caching and filtering configuration |

**Config Object Fields:**

| Field         | Type    | Required | Default | Description                                                     |
| ------------- | ------- | -------- | ------- | --------------------------------------------------------------- |
| `expDays`     | integer | No       | `30`    | Number of days until cached toolset expires                     |
| `filter`      | string  | No       | -       | Filter type: `"only"`, `"except"`, `"tags"`, `"withoutTags"`    |
| `filterValue` | string  | No       | -       | Comma-separated list of tool names or tags (required if filter) |

#### MCP Server Examples

**STDIO Server with Filtering:**

```json theme={null}
{
  "mcp_servers": {
    "filesystem": {
      "command": "npx",
      "args": ["-y", "@modelcontextprotocol/server-filesystem", "/workspace"],
      "env": {
        "DEBUG": "1"
      },
      "config": {
        "expDays": 7,
        "filter": "except",
        "filterValue": "delete_file,format_disk"
      }
    }
  }
}
```

**HTTP Server with Authentication:**

```json theme={null}
{
  "mcp_servers": {
    "api_server": {
      "type": "http",
      "url": "https://api.example.com/mcp/",
      "headers": {
        "Authorization": "Bearer {{env.API_TOKEN}}"
      },
      "config": {
        "expDays": 30
      }
    }
  }
}
```

**Multiple MCP Servers:**

```json theme={null}
{
  "mcp_servers": {
    "memory": {
      "command": "uvx",
      "args": ["mcp-server-memory"]
    },
    "github": {
      "type": "http",
      "url": "https://api.githubcopilot.com/mcp/",
      "headers": {
        "Authorization": "Bearer {{env.GITHUB_MCP_PAT}}"
      },
      "config": {
        "expDays": 14,
        "filter": "tags",
        "filterValue": "read,search"
      }
    }
  }
}
```

**How MCP Servers Work:**

1. **First Load**: When the schema is loaded, MCI connects to each MCP server and fetches all available tools
2. **Caching**: Tools are saved as standard MCI toolset files in `{libraryDir}/mcp/{serverName}.mci.json`
3. **Subsequent Loads**: Cached toolsets are used instead of connecting to the server (much faster)
4. **Expiration**: When cache expires (based on `expDays`), tools are re-fetched from the server
5. **Filtering**: Optional filters are applied when tools are registered
6. **Templating**: Server configurations support `{{env.VAR}}` templating for credentials

## Toolset Schema Files

Toolset files are MCI schema files stored in the library directory (default: `./mci`). They provide a way to organize and reuse tool collections across different main schemas.

### Toolset File Structure

Toolset files have a simplified structure compared to main schemas:

| Field           | Type   | Required     | Description                                 |
| --------------- | ------ | ------------ | ------------------------------------------- |
| `schemaVersion` | string | **Required** | MCI schema version (must match main schema) |
| `metadata`      | object | Optional     | Descriptive metadata about the toolset      |
| `tools`         | array  | **Required** | Array of tool definitions                   |

**Important Differences from Main Schema**:

* `tools` field is **required** in toolset files (optional in main schema)
* Cannot contain `toolsets`, `libraryDir`, `enableAnyPaths`, or `directoryAllowList` fields
* These are purely tool definition files, not configuration files

### Example Toolset File (JSON)

**File**: `./mci/weather.mci.json`

```json theme={null}
{
  "schemaVersion": "1.0",
  "metadata": {
    "name": "Weather Toolset",
    "description": "Tools for weather information",
    "version": "1.0.0"
  },
  "tools": [
    {
      "name": "get_weather",
      "description": "Get current weather",
      "tags": ["weather", "read"],
      "inputSchema": {
        "type": "object",
        "properties": {
          "location": {
            "type": "string",
            "description": "City name or location"
          }
        },
        "required": ["location"]
      },
      "execution": {
        "type": "http",
        "method": "GET",
        "url": "https://api.weather.com/current",
        "params": {
          "location": "{{props.location}}"
        }
      }
    },
    {
      "name": "get_forecast",
      "description": "Get weather forecast",
      "tags": ["weather", "read"],
      "execution": {
        "type": "http",
        "method": "GET",
        "url": "https://api.weather.com/forecast",
        "params": {
          "location": "{{props.location}}",
          "days": "{{props.days}}"
        }
      }
    }
  ]
}
```

### Toolset Directory Structure

You can organize related toolsets in subdirectories:

```
project/
├── main.mci.json          # Main schema
└── mci/                   # Library directory
    ├── weather.mci.json   # Single-file toolset
    ├── database.mci.json  # Single-file toolset
    └── github/            # Directory-based toolset
        ├── prs.mci.json   # GitHub PR tools
        └── issues.mci.json # GitHub issue tools
```

When referencing a directory-based toolset:

```json theme={null}
{
  "toolsets": [
    { "name": "github" } // Loads all .mci.json files in mci/github/
  ]
}
```

**Important notes for directory-based toolsets:**

* Only tools are merged from toolset files; metadata is not merged
* All files in a directory must use the same schema version
* Schema version mismatch will raise an error to ensure compatibility

**Metadata in toolset files:**

* Metadata in toolset files is for demonstration and documentation purposes only
* It helps credit toolset authors and provides human-friendly descriptions
* Metadata is never merged into the main schema from toolset files

## Tool Definition

Each tool in the `tools` array represents a single executable operation.

| Field                | Type    | Required     | Description                                                       |
| -------------------- | ------- | ------------ | ----------------------------------------------------------------- |
| `name`               | string  | **Required** | Unique identifier for the tool                                    |
| `disabled`           | boolean | Optional     | If true, the tool is ignored (default: `false`)                   |
| `annotations`        | object  | Optional     | Metadata and behavioral hints (see [Annotations](#annotations))   |
| `description`        | string  | Optional     | Description of what the tool does                                 |
| `inputSchema`        | object  | Optional     | JSON Schema describing expected inputs                            |
| `execution`          | object  | **Required** | Execution configuration (see [Execution Types](#execution-types)) |
| `enableAnyPaths`     | boolean | Optional     | Override schema-level path restriction (default: `false`)         |
| `directoryAllowList` | array   | Optional     | Override schema-level allowed directories (default: `[]`)         |
| `tags`               | array   | Optional     | Array of string tags for filtering (default: `[]`)                |

### Tags

**`tags`** (array of strings, default: `[]`)

* List of tags for categorizing and filtering tools
* Tags are case-sensitive and matched exactly as provided
* Used with `tags()` and `withoutTags()` filter methods in MCIClient and ToolManager
* Tools can have zero or more tags
* Common tag examples: `"api"`, `"database"`, `"internal"`, `"external"`, `"deprecated"`

### Disabled Tools

**`disabled`** (boolean, default: `false`)

* When `true`, the tool is excluded from all listing, filtering, and lookup operations
* Disabled tools cannot be executed and behave as if they do not exist
* Useful for temporarily deactivating tools without removing them from the schema

### Annotations

The `annotations` object provides optional metadata and behavioral hints about the tool. All fields are optional.

| Field             | Type    | Description                                                      |
| ----------------- | ------- | ---------------------------------------------------------------- |
| `title`           | string  | Human-readable title for the tool                                |
| `readOnlyHint`    | boolean | If true, the tool does not modify its environment                |
| `destructiveHint` | boolean | If true, the tool may perform destructive updates                |
| `idempotentHint`  | boolean | If true, repeated calls with same args have no additional effect |
| `openWorldHint`   | boolean | If true, the tool interacts with external entities               |

**Note:** These hints are advisory and do not enforce any behavior. They help AI agents understand the tool's characteristics for better decision-making.

### Security Fields (Per-Tool)

**`enableAnyPaths`** (boolean, default: `false`)

* Overrides schema-level setting for this specific tool
* When `true`, disables path validation for this tool
* Takes precedence over schema-level `enableAnyPaths`

**`directoryAllowList`** (array of strings, default: `[]`)

* Overrides schema-level setting for this specific tool
* List of additional directories allowed for this tool only
* Takes precedence over schema-level `directoryAllowList`
* Can be absolute or relative paths

## Execution Types

MCI supports four execution types: `http`, `cli`, `file`, and `text`. The `type` field in the `execution` object determines which executor is used.

### HTTP Execution

Execute HTTP requests to external APIs.

**Type**: `"http"`

#### Fields

| Field        | Type    | Required     | Default | Description                                                             |
| ------------ | ------- | ------------ | ------- | ----------------------------------------------------------------------- |
| `type`       | string  | **Required** | -       | Must be `"http"`                                                        |
| `method`     | string  | Optional     | `"GET"` | HTTP method: `GET`, `POST`, `PUT`, `PATCH`, `DELETE`, `HEAD`, `OPTIONS` |
| `url`        | string  | **Required** | -       | Target URL (supports templating)                                        |
| `headers`    | object  | Optional     | -       | HTTP headers as key-value pairs (supports templating)                   |
| `auth`       | object  | Optional     | -       | Authentication configuration (see [Authentication](#authentication))    |
| `params`     | object  | Optional     | -       | Query parameters as key-value pairs (supports templating)               |
| `body`       | object  | Optional     | -       | Request body configuration                                              |
| `timeout_ms` | integer | Optional     | `30000` | Request timeout in milliseconds (must be ≥ 0)                           |
| `retries`    | object  | Optional     | -       | Retry configuration                                                     |

#### Body Configuration

The `body` field defines the request body:

| Field     | Type          | Required     | Description                                         |
| --------- | ------------- | ------------ | --------------------------------------------------- |
| `type`    | string        | **Required** | Body type: `"json"`, `"form"`, or `"raw"`           |
| `content` | object/string | **Required** | Body content (object for json/form, string for raw) |

#### Retry Configuration

The `retries` field configures retry behavior:

| Field        | Type    | Required | Default | Description                                 |
| ------------ | ------- | -------- | ------- | ------------------------------------------- |
| `attempts`   | integer | Optional | `1`     | Number of retry attempts (must be ≥ 1)      |
| `backoff_ms` | integer | Optional | `500`   | Backoff delay in milliseconds (must be ≥ 0) |

#### Examples

**GET Request with Query Parameters**

```json theme={null}
{
  "type": "http",
  "method": "GET",
  "url": "https://api.example.com/weather",
  "params": {
    "location": "{{props.location}}",
    "units": "metric"
  },
  "headers": {
    "Accept": "application/json"
  },
  "timeout_ms": 5000
}
```

**POST Request with JSON Body**

```json theme={null}
{
  "type": "http",
  "method": "POST",
  "url": "https://api.example.com/reports",
  "headers": {
    "Content-Type": "application/json",
    "Accept": "application/json"
  },
  "body": {
    "type": "json",
    "content": {
      "title": "{{props.title}}",
      "content": "{{props.content}}",
      "timestamp": "{{env.CURRENT_TIMESTAMP}}"
    }
  },
  "timeout_ms": 10000
}
```

**POST Request with Form Data**

```json theme={null}
{
  "type": "http",
  "method": "POST",
  "url": "https://api.example.com/upload",
  "body": {
    "type": "form",
    "content": {
      "filename": "{{props.filename}}",
      "category": "documents"
    }
  }
}
```

**Request with Retry Logic**

```json theme={null}
{
  "type": "http",
  "method": "GET",
  "url": "https://api.example.com/data",
  "retries": {
    "attempts": 3,
    "backoff_ms": 1000
  }
}
```

***

### CLI Execution

Execute command-line tools and scripts.

**Type**: `"cli"`

#### Fields

| Field        | Type    | Required     | Default | Description                                     |
| ------------ | ------- | ------------ | ------- | ----------------------------------------------- |
| `type`       | string  | **Required** | -       | Must be `"cli"`                                 |
| `command`    | string  | **Required** | -       | Command to execute                              |
| `args`       | array   | Optional     | -       | Fixed positional arguments                      |
| `flags`      | object  | Optional     | -       | Dynamic flags mapped from properties            |
| `cwd`        | string  | Optional     | -       | Working directory (supports templating)         |
| `timeout_ms` | integer | Optional     | `30000` | Execution timeout in milliseconds (must be ≥ 0) |

#### Flag Configuration

Each flag in the `flags` object has:

| Field  | Type   | Required     | Description                                 |
| ------ | ------ | ------------ | ------------------------------------------- |
| `from` | string | **Required** | Property path (e.g., `"props.ignore_case"`) |
| `type` | string | **Required** | Flag type: `"boolean"` or `"value"`         |

* **`boolean`**: Flag is included only if the property is truthy (e.g., `-i`)
* **`value`**: Flag is included with the property value (e.g., `--file=myfile.txt`)

#### Examples

**Basic CLI Command**

```json theme={null}
{
  "type": "cli",
  "command": "grep",
  "args": ["-r", "-n"],
  "flags": {
    "-i": {
      "from": "props.ignore_case",
      "type": "boolean"
    }
  },
  "cwd": "{{props.directory}}",
  "timeout_ms": 8000
}
```

**CLI with Value Flags**

```json theme={null}
{
  "type": "cli",
  "command": "convert",
  "args": ["input.png"],
  "flags": {
    "--resize": {
      "from": "props.size",
      "type": "value"
    },
    "--quality": {
      "from": "props.quality",
      "type": "value"
    }
  },
  "cwd": "/tmp"
}
```

***

### File Execution

Read and parse file contents with optional templating.

**Type**: `"file"`

#### Fields

| Field              | Type    | Required     | Default | Description                                  |
| ------------------ | ------- | ------------ | ------- | -------------------------------------------- |
| `type`             | string  | **Required** | -       | Must be `"file"`                             |
| `path`             | string  | **Required** | -       | File path (supports templating)              |
| `enableTemplating` | boolean | Optional     | `true`  | Whether to process templates in file content |

When `enableTemplating` is `true`, the file contents are processed with the full templating engine (basic placeholders, loops, and conditionals).

#### Examples

**Load Template File**

```json theme={null}
{
  "type": "file",
  "path": "./templates/report-{{props.report_id}}.txt",
  "enableTemplating": true
}
```

**Load Raw File**

```json theme={null}
{
  "type": "file",
  "path": "/etc/config/settings.json",
  "enableTemplating": false
}
```

***

### Text Execution

Return templated text directly.

**Type**: `"text"`

#### Fields

| Field  | Type   | Required     | Description                         |
| ------ | ------ | ------------ | ----------------------------------- |
| `type` | string | **Required** | Must be `"text"`                    |
| `text` | string | **Required** | Text template (supports templating) |

The text is processed with the full templating engine (basic placeholders, loops, and conditionals).

#### Examples

**Simple Message**

```json theme={null}
{
  "type": "text",
  "text": "Hello {{props.username}}! This message was generated on {{env.CURRENT_DATE}}."
}
```

**Report with Conditionals**

```json theme={null}
{
  "type": "text",
  "text": "Report for {{props.username}}\n@if(props.premium)Premium features enabled@else Standard features available @endif"
}
```

## Authentication

HTTP execution supports four authentication types: API Key, Bearer Token, Basic Auth, and OAuth2.

### API Key Authentication

Pass an API key in headers or query parameters.

**Type**: `"apiKey"`

#### Fields

| Field   | Type   | Required     | Description                                                      |
| ------- | ------ | ------------ | ---------------------------------------------------------------- |
| `type`  | string | **Required** | Must be `"apiKey"`                                               |
| `in`    | string | **Required** | Where to send the key: `"header"` or `"query"`                   |
| `name`  | string | **Required** | Header/query parameter name                                      |
| `value` | string | **Required** | API key value (supports templating, typically `{{env.API_KEY}}`) |

#### Examples

**API Key in Header**

```json theme={null}
{
  "type": "http",
  "method": "GET",
  "url": "https://api.example.com/data",
  "auth": {
    "type": "apiKey",
    "in": "header",
    "name": "X-API-Key",
    "value": "{{env.API_KEY}}"
  }
}
```

**API Key in Query Parameter**

```json theme={null}
{
  "type": "http",
  "method": "GET",
  "url": "https://api.example.com/data",
  "auth": {
    "type": "apiKey",
    "in": "query",
    "name": "api_key",
    "value": "{{env.API_KEY}}"
  }
}
```

***

### Bearer Token Authentication

Pass a bearer token in the `Authorization` header.

**Type**: `"bearer"`

#### Fields

| Field   | Type   | Required     | Description                                                          |
| ------- | ------ | ------------ | -------------------------------------------------------------------- |
| `type`  | string | **Required** | Must be `"bearer"`                                                   |
| `token` | string | **Required** | Bearer token (supports templating, typically `{{env.BEARER_TOKEN}}`) |

#### Example

```json theme={null}
{
  "type": "http",
  "method": "POST",
  "url": "https://api.example.com/reports",
  "auth": {
    "type": "bearer",
    "token": "{{env.BEARER_TOKEN}}"
  },
  "body": {
    "type": "json",
    "content": {
      "title": "{{props.title}}"
    }
  }
}
```

***

### Basic Authentication

Use HTTP Basic Authentication with username and password.

**Type**: `"basic"`

#### Fields

| Field      | Type   | Required     | Description                                                  |
| ---------- | ------ | ------------ | ------------------------------------------------------------ |
| `type`     | string | **Required** | Must be `"basic"`                                            |
| `username` | string | **Required** | Username (supports templating, typically `{{env.USERNAME}}`) |
| `password` | string | **Required** | Password (supports templating, typically `{{env.PASSWORD}}`) |

#### Example

```json theme={null}
{
  "type": "http",
  "method": "GET",
  "url": "https://api.example.com/private-data",
  "auth": {
    "type": "basic",
    "username": "{{env.USERNAME}}",
    "password": "{{env.PASSWORD}}"
  }
}
```

***

### OAuth2 Authentication

Authenticate using OAuth2 client credentials flow.

**Type**: `"oauth2"`

#### Fields

| Field          | Type   | Required     | Description                                    |
| -------------- | ------ | ------------ | ---------------------------------------------- |
| `type`         | string | **Required** | Must be `"oauth2"`                             |
| `flow`         | string | **Required** | OAuth2 flow type (e.g., `"clientCredentials"`) |
| `tokenUrl`     | string | **Required** | Token endpoint URL                             |
| `clientId`     | string | **Required** | OAuth2 client ID (supports templating)         |
| `clientSecret` | string | **Required** | OAuth2 client secret (supports templating)     |
| `scopes`       | array  | Optional     | Array of scope strings                         |

#### Example

```json theme={null}
{
  "type": "http",
  "method": "GET",
  "url": "https://api.example.com/weather",
  "auth": {
    "type": "oauth2",
    "flow": "clientCredentials",
    "tokenUrl": "https://auth.example.com/token",
    "clientId": "{{env.CLIENT_ID}}",
    "clientSecret": "{{env.CLIENT_SECRET}}",
    "scopes": ["read:weather", "read:forecast"]
  }
}
```

## Templating Syntax

The MCI templating engine supports placeholder substitution, loops, and conditional blocks. Templating is available in:

* Execution configurations (URLs, headers, params, body, etc.)
* File contents (when `enableTemplating: true`)
* Text execution

### Context Structure

The templating engine has access to three contexts:

* **`props`**: Properties passed to `execute()` method
* **`env`**: Environment variables passed to the adapter
* **`input`**: Alias for `props` (for backward compatibility)

### Basic Placeholders

Replace placeholders with values from the context.

**Syntax**: `{{path.to.value}}`

#### Examples

```
{{props.location}}
{{env.API_KEY}}
{{input.username}}
{{props.user.name}}
{{env.DATABASE_URL}}
```

**In JSON**:

```json theme={null}
{
  "url": "https://api.example.com/users/{{props.user_id}}",
  "headers": {
    "Authorization": "Bearer {{env.ACCESS_TOKEN}}",
    "X-Request-ID": "{{props.request_id}}"
  }
}
```

***

### For Loops

Iterate a fixed number of times using a range.

**Syntax**: `@for(variable in range(start, end))...@endfor`

* `variable`: Loop variable name
* `start`: Starting value (inclusive)
* `end`: Ending value (exclusive)

#### Example

**Template**:

```
@for(i in range(0, 3))
Item {{i}}
@endfor
```

**Output**:

```
Item 0
Item 1
Item 2
```

***

### Foreach Loops

Iterate over arrays or objects from the context.

**Syntax**: `@foreach(variable in path.to.collection)...@endforeach`

* `variable`: Loop variable name
* `path.to.collection`: Path to an array or object in the context

#### Array Example

**Context**:

```json theme={null}
{
  "props": {
    "items": ["Apple", "Banana", "Cherry"]
  }
}
```

**Template**:

```
@foreach(item in props.items)
- {{item}}
@endforeach
```

**Output**:

```
- Apple
- Banana
- Cherry
```

#### Object Example

**Context**:

```json theme={null}
{
  "props": {
    "users": [
      { "name": "Alice", "age": 30 },
      { "name": "Bob", "age": 25 }
    ]
  }
}
```

**Template**:

```
@foreach(user in props.users)
Name: {{user.name}}, Age: {{user.age}}
@endforeach
```

**Output**:

```
Name: Alice, Age: 30
Name: Bob, Age: 25
```

***

### Conditional Blocks

Execute code conditionally based on values in the context.

**Syntax**:

```
@if(condition)
...
@elseif(condition)
...
@else
...
@endif
```

#### Supported Conditions

* **Truthy check**: `@if(path.to.value)`
* **Equality**: `@if(path.to.value == "expected")`
* **Inequality**: `@if(path.to.value != "unexpected")`
* **Greater than**: `@if(path.to.value > 10)`
* **Less than**: `@if(path.to.value < 100)`

#### Examples

**Simple Conditional**:

```
@if(props.premium)
You have premium access!
@else
Upgrade to premium for more features.
@endif
```

**Multiple Conditions**:

```
@if(props.status == "active")
Status: Active
@elseif(props.status == "pending")
Status: Pending approval
@else
Status: Inactive
@endif
```

**Numeric Comparison**:

```
@if(props.age > 18)
Adult content available
@else
Restricted content
@endif
```

## Execution Result Format

All tool executions return a consistent result format.

| Field      | Type    | Description                                               |
| ---------- | ------- | --------------------------------------------------------- |
| `isError`  | boolean | Whether an error occurred during execution                |
| `content`  | any     | Result content (if successful)                            |
| `error`    | string  | Error message (if `isError: true`)                        |
| `metadata` | object  | Optional metadata (e.g., HTTP status code, CLI exit code) |

### Metadata Fields by Execution Type

Different execution types include specific metadata:

**HTTP Execution Metadata:**

* `status_code` (integer): HTTP status code
* `response_time_ms` (integer): Response time in milliseconds

**CLI Execution Metadata:**

* `exit_code` (integer): Command exit code (0 for success, non-zero for failure)
* `stdout_bytes` (integer): Size of stdout in bytes
* `stderr_bytes` (integer): Size of stderr in bytes
* `stderr` (string): Standard error output (if any)
* `stdout` (string): Standard output (only included in error results)

### Successful Result

```json theme={null}
{
  "isError": false,
  "content": [
    {
      "type": "text",
      "text": "Current weather in New York:\nTemperature: 72°F\nConditions: Partly cloudy"
    }
  ],
  "metadata": {
    "status_code": 200,
    "response_time_ms": 245
  }
}
```

### CLI Successful Result

```json theme={null}
{
  "isError": false,
  "content": [
    {
      "type": "text",
      "text": "Hello, World!\n"
    }
  ],
  "metadata": {
    "exit_code": 0,
    "stdout_bytes": 14,
    "stderr_bytes": 0,
    "stderr": ""
  }
}
```

### Error Result

```json theme={null}
{
  "isError": true,
  "error": "HTTP request failed: 404 Not Found",
  "metadata": {
    "status_code": 404
  }
}
```

### CLI Error Result

```json theme={null}
{
  "isError": true,
  "error": "Command exited with code 1: permission denied",
  "metadata": {
    "exit_code": 1,
    "stdout_bytes": 0,
    "stderr_bytes": 18,
    "stderr": "permission denied",
    "stdout": ""
  }
}
```
